P. Diddy to Start Selling Guinness and Red Stripe???

Alan Kropf / Sat, Jun 27

AdAge.com reported that P. Diddy is in talks with Diageo to promote its Guinness and Red Stripe brands. The announcement drew 3 comments by readers, all sharing the same perspective:

1) Oh boy! I can’t wait! Psych.
2) I am speechless. Just a terrible idea.
3) Why does anyone pay attention to this self-absorbed phony?

P. Diddy currently promotes another Diageo brand, Ciroc Vodka, in a deal that sends 50% of the brand’s profits to the hip hop mogul.

According to AdAge, “The musician-turned-entrepreneur, who teamed up with Diageo in 2007 to manage and promote its Ciroc vodka brand, has held talks with the British beverage behemoth about working on its Guinness and Red Stripe beer brands, according to people familiar with the matter.
